Texas lands Corona as official sponsor

John Gutierrez / USA TODAY Sports

Texas has a new beer of choice.

The Longhorns agreed to a partnership with Corona as an official sponsor, per release.

"There really isn't anything more emblematic of the state of Texas than the storied history of the four-time football national champion Texas Longhorns," said John Alvarado, vice president of marketing for Corona Extra. "Corona is honored to be a part of the legendary Longhorns lore, and we're excited to raise our Coronas and Hook 'em Horns this season as part of a statewide platform."

Corona will also be using the slogan, "Horns up, Limes In!" as part of the marketing campaign and the agreement will run for five years, according to Bill King of Sports Business Daily.

"Texas is proud to join with the Corona Extra team to promote the excitement and pageantry of collegiate sports," Texas athletics director Mike Perrin said.

The Longhorns began selling beer at home games in 2015 and fans will get their first taste of Corona Royal-Memorial Stadium when Texas hosts Maryland on Sept. 2.
